KBSA announces guest speaker for KBB Industry Conference 2025

Alina Addison, author, leadership coach and founder of executive coaching company ADAPTAA.

The Kitchen Bathroom Bedroom Specialists Association (KBSA) has invited Alina Addison as guest speaker for its KBB Industry Conference 2025 at The Belfry Hotel and Resort.

The author, leadership coach and founder of executive coaching company ADAPTAA, will take to the conference stage on Wednesday, October 1.

A former managing director at Rothschild and chartered accountant with PwC, Addison is the author of the book ‘The Audacity Spectrum’, a guide to helping leaders embrace their unique strengths.

Alongside her corporate achievements, she co-owns a boutique hotel in Transylvania, where she hosts annual retreats designed to challenge, inspire and empower leaders to step fully into their power.

Her presentation, titled ‘Are You a Leader or a Boss?’, will explore the link between fearless leadership and emotional intelligence. Drawing on insights from her book, Addison will challenge delegates to reflect on their own leadership style.

“We are delighted that Alina will be joining us this year,” says KBSA chair Richard Hibbert. “Her unique perspective on bold, values-led leadership will be an inspiring addition to our programme.

“With her wealth of experience and passion for empowering others, Alina is set to spark powerful conversations and fresh thinking among our delegates.”

The KBB Industry Conference 2025 will once again feature a retailer dinner on the evening before the event, September 30, followed by the KBSA Designer Awards dinner after the conference on October 1.
